CVE-2006-2319
Ideal Science Ideal BB 1.5.4a and earlier does not properly check file extensions before permitting an upload, which allows remote attackers to upload and execute an ASP script via a 0x00 character before the ".asp" portion of the filename...

CVE-2006-2318
Incomplete blacklist vulnerability in Ideal Science Ideal BB 1.5.4a and earlier allows remote attackers to upload and execute an ASP script via a ".asa" file, which bypasses the check for the ".asp" extension but is executable on the server...

CVE-2006-2319
CVE-2006-2319 affects Ideal Science Ideal BB 1.5.4a and earlier. The vulnerability arises from improper validation of file extensions before upload, allowing a remote attacker to insert a 0x00 character before the ".asp" portion of a filename to upload and execute an ASP script on the server.
